49. Live in love

1 In heaven awakes the gentle strain,
Live in love, live in love:
And earth repeats the sound again,
Live in love, live in love.
Where'er the tears of sorrow flow,
And the heart is filled with woe,
There speak in accents soft and low,
Live, oh, live in love.
In heaven awakes the gentle strain,
Live in love, live in love:
And earth repeats the sound again,
Live in love, live in love.

2 Soft angel voices chant the song,
Live in love, live in love:
And we below the notes prolong,
Live in love, live in love.
And when the heart from care is free,
When the time glides merrily,
Then that sweet voice still calls for thee,
Live, oh, live in love.
Soft angel voices chant the song,
Live in love, live in love:
And we below the notes prolong,
Live in love, live in love.
